Emerging Challenges in Embodied Intelligence: Data Quality vs. Quantity for Robots

At the WRC, insights revealed that the next phase of embodied intelligence is facing a paradox: the scarcity lies not in data volume but in the physical world representation within that data. Over the past year, numerous training centers have emerged across China, with over 90 expected to be operational by mid-2026, generating millions of data points. However, only a fraction of this data is applicable to real-world tasks, indicating a potential issue as the industry approaches commercialization.

This situation is critical because, unlike language models, robots cannot rely on the internet for training; they must navigate real-world complexities such as friction and collisions. The founder of Orbbec, Dr. Huang Yuanhao, emphasized that while digital intelligence thrives on vast amounts of text data, embodied intelligence requires experiential learning from human operators, which is currently lacking.

Recent research indicates a shift in focus from merely increasing demonstration data to enhancing 3D spatial understanding for foundational robot training. Innovations like FreeTacMan's wearable devices are also emerging, allowing humans to gather rich interaction data directly. As the industry explores these new avenues, the question remains whether the bottleneck in robot training is due to insufficient data or the high costs and limitations of current data production methods.
